Ontario lawyers are soon going to be electing the Benchers who oversee the Law Society - and since lawyers are a self-regulating profession, that's more important than it might at first sound. Rebecca Durcan is running for Bencher, and in this conversation we talk about the risks that professions pose to the public, the ongoing controversies that have resulted in this election being - for the first time in history - contested by two slates of opposing lawyers, and why this might end up being the last Bencher election.
